Description"The Camp Goonzhii curriculum includes the western science and traditional ecological knowledge (TEK) module combined with indoor and outdoor learning experiences through demonstrations and hands on environmental education activities. The camp is a very important community outreach tool because it gives the students many indoor and outdoor activities that are taught by the refuge staff and elders who share their wise and intelligent wisdom about the land and animals, but ultimately, the students are the ones who enhance and embrace the camp by participating and carry on the legacy of new discovery and exposure to new technologies taught by the unique instructors and elders who have so much to give and share. The end result is the students, young and old, are all looking forward to the camp every year and especially the new generation of students who are more excited and ready to learn about new age of traditional and scientific knowledge.
